Output ef2754e9f0ce2dd156d2a38a14272a646f20d456a0a4adfa5b86aeadf8882a07:17

value
1604428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c721446e15fa438e583afb0d56bc3d4749605ea OP_EQUAL
address
34HRWH2sY3qGruTxZrsYShDqSu2dnA3Ytw
transaction
ef2754e9f0ce2dd156d2a38a14272a646f20d456a0a4adfa5b86aeadf8882a07
spent
true